Craige Stout is the Chief Executive Officer of Stout, the global advisory and investment banking firm he founded in 1991. With expertise in valuation, M&A, and litigation advisory, he has overseen more than 1, 000 projects. He holds both a B. A. and an MBA in Accounting from Michigan State University.

He is actively involved in the community, serving on the boards of non-profits like the Junior Achievement of Chicago and the Museum of Science and Industry. He grew up in East Lansing where his father was a professor at Michigan State, and he follows MSU sports closely.

Craige founded his firm just five years after graduating from college, starting with a two-person team in a living room.
